Comprehending Limited Liability Company State Inquiry
An inquiry into LLCs is a necessary tool for anyone looking to gather thorough information about a limited liability company. This search process allows individuals and organizations to confirm the validity of an LLC, review its status, and review its registration details. Each state in the USA maintains its own database of registered entities, which can generally be retrieved via the internet. By conducting a state-specific search, users can ensure they are receiving the most accurate and up-to-date data regarding any LLC functioning within that jurisdiction.
Conducting an LLC state search is especially important for potential business partners, investors, or clients who want to establish trust and confirm the legitimacy of a business. It offers information into important factors such as the LLC’s formation date, registered agent, and whether the LLC is in good standing with the jurisdiction. This due diligence can help avoid fraud and guarantee that transactions are made with trustworthy entities, protecting both resources and image.
The process of conducting an LLC inquiry is generally straightforward. Users can visit their respective state's department website and proceed to the business entity search area. By entering the LLC's title or distinct identification number, they can get critical data.
